Overall purpose of role

Assist the Lead/Senior Document Controller in managing project documentation efficiently and ensuring timely delivery.

Primary responsibilities, authorities & accountabilities

  • Fully aware of and adhere to all document control procedures.
  • Understand process flows, responsibility matrices, document inflow intervals, document maturity, confidentiality, archiving, and retention management.
  • Proficient in using internal Electronic Document Management Systems (EDMS) and client-specific EDMS platforms.
  • Coordinate all incoming and outgoing documentation from internal departments, clients, suppliers, and subcontractors.
  • Perform quality assurance checks on documents, ensuring accuracy, completeness, compliance, correct orientation, clarity, legibility, and absence of typographical errors or duplication before uploading to the EDMS and transmitting.
  • Obtain acknowledgments for documents delivered daily.
  • Maintain the latest document revisions in the EDMS and ensure they are readily accessible to authorized users.
  • Establish and maintain the initial access matrix for the project folder structure based on the organizational chart, and keep the folder request register up to date.
  • Organize and file hardcopy documents systematically.
  • Assist with the compilation and issuance of final documentation.
  • Ensure compliance with company, department, and project-specific procedures.
  • Adhere to applicable information security policies and procedures.
  • Comply with Health, Safety & Environmental (HSE) responsibilities.
